Output 861125b61f1d05331976d7b21d744943a8471d55ef9965e034ca504f01b47fd2:79

value
500000
script pubkey
OP_0 OP_PUSHBYTES_20 51377032ccfa3d1667c786c9b884260e5232979f
address
bc1q2ymhqvkvlg73ve78smym3ppxpefr99uljnmakt
transaction
861125b61f1d05331976d7b21d744943a8471d55ef9965e034ca504f01b47fd2